PVC waterproofing membrane, also known as polyester fiber inner reinforced polyvinyl chloride (PVC) waterproofing membrane, is a thermoplastic PVC membrane.
The coil is a polymer coil formed by combining the double-sided polyvinyl chloride plastic layer and the middle polyester reinforcing rib through a special extrusion coating process with polyester fiber fabric as a reinforcing rib. The combination of an advanced polyvinyl chloride plastic layer and a mesh-structured polyester fabric provides the roll with excellent dimensional stability and a low coefficient of thermal expansion. Improves long-term performance of coils directly exposed to the elements. Construction method: hot air welding, so as to ensure the effect of the weld.
